1. What to Look for in Hair Clippers

Before choosing a pair of clippers, consider the following key features:

Motor Power

Stronger motors cut through thick or coarse hair without snagging. Professional models often use rotary or magnetic motors for consistent performance.

Blade Quality

Stainless steel, titanium and self‑sharpening blades offer durability and precision. Some models include adjustable taper levers for fades.

Battery Life

Modern cordless clippers offer 60–180 minutes of runtime. Fast‑charging is a bonus for busy households.

Length Settings

Look for a wide range of guards, especially if you switch between short buzz cuts and longer trims.

Maintenance

Waterproof models are easier to clean, while oil‑free blades reduce upkeep.

6. Final Grooming Tips

For best results, start with clean, dry hair and use longer guards first before working down. Oil your blades regularly if your model requires it, and clean the guards after each use to maintain hygiene and performance.
